How You Don’t Believe Android Organized? Try This Secret Trick to Tame Your Files Actually Works
The core principle is focused simplicity: instead of starting with structure, begin by categorizing files through clear, intuitive tags and smart search habits. By using Android’s built-in file management tools—like folder labeling, quick search filters, and cloud sync settings—users regain control without friction. The secret trick? Profile your habits first: notice what files feel most important, where clutter builds up, and when you reach for your device. Then, apply minimal, consistent naming and sorting routines that reinforce order through repetition, not radical redesign.

Q: Isn’t organizing Android files complicated?
It doesn’t have to be. Start small—use consistent folder names, enable search filters, and let cloud storage auto-sync key files for instant access.
Q: What if I don’t want manual sorting every day?
Automation helps. Set up file rules—like movie or downloads folders that auto-categorize—and run daily quick scans to keep things fresh with minimal effort.
